® WorleyParsons <br /> resources&energy <br /> • Minimum radius of curvature of 50 feet(centerline)unless restricted. <br /> • AASHTO HS-20-44 loading conditions (minimum requirement). <br /> • Maximum longitudinal slope of 5 percent (except as required for short distances for <br /> site entrance and exit roads in which case 8%will not be exceeded). <br /> • Maximum transverse gradient of 2 percent. <br /> • The road to the CT Generator from the plant loop road will be flat (0% slope) for a <br /> minimum distance of 70 feet from the face of the generator. <br /> 2.2.9 Wetlands Protection <br /> Wetlands will be protected during construction as required and to comply with <br /> requirements specified by any laws, codes, and permits. <br /> 2.2.10 Landscaping and Fencing <br /> A detailed landscape design, fine grading, furnishing and placement of trees, shrubbery, <br /> and/or grass, will be prepared. Any embankment area around the perimeter of the power <br /> block and any unpaved areas on site will be gravel. <br /> Any offsite area that is disturbed during construction will be hydro-seeded and restored to <br /> the original contours. <br /> A single chain-link fence around the site boundary, with a single 24-foot-wide automatic <br /> slide main gate, with a keypad for vehicle use, located at the main entrance will be <br /> provided. One manually operated vehicle gate located at another access point around the <br /> site will also be provided if an additional vehicle entrance is shown on the Site General <br /> Arrangement. The centerline of fence will be at least 6" inside of the property line to <br /> assure construction on Owner's property. <br /> 2.3 Civil/Structural Design Requirements <br /> 2.3.1 Geotechnical Report <br /> The project equipment foundations will be designed to the meet the requirements of the <br /> Geotechnical Report that was prepared during the plant development. <br /> 2.3.2 Codes and Standards <br /> The governing building code, CBC2007 and local/state-building codes will be <br /> incorporated into the design of buildings and structures. Steel structures will be designed <br /> in accordance with the design specifications for structural steel buildings published by the <br /> American Institute of Steel Construction (AISC). Reinforced concrete structures will be <br /> designed in accordance with the design requirements for concrete buildings and structures <br /> published by the American Concrete Institute (ACI). <br /> Lodi Energy Center 3.2-4 LEC AFC <br /> 071608 Rev.A <br />
